Lincoln, Nebraska – The state of Nebraska recently made headlines as lawmakers took a stand against proposed changes to the electoral system backed by former President Donald Trump. In a surprising turn of events, legislators in the Cornhusker State rejected the Trump-supported measure, highlighting a growing divide within the Republican Party over election policies.

The failed proposal aimed to alter Nebraska’s electoral vote allocation process, a move that garnered both support and opposition across party lines. While Trump and his allies pushed for the change, critics argued that the proposed adjustments could have significant implications for future elections. The decision to block the measure showcases the ongoing debate surrounding election integrity and the role of state legislatures in shaping voting procedures.
